<dfn id="w48us"></dfn><ul id="w48us"></ul>
  • <ul id="w48us"></ul>
  • <del id="w48us"></del>
    <ul id="w48us"></ul>
  • 怎樣理解jquery中ajax的dataType屬性選項值

    時間:2024-07-15 17:03:14 AJAX 我要投稿
    • 相關推薦

    怎樣理解jquery中ajax的dataType屬性選項值

      jquery中ajax的dataType屬性用于指定服務器返回的數據類型,如果不指定,jQuery 將自動根據HTTP包MIME信息來智能判斷,如果datatype選項不填寫的話,會將返回的數據當成字符串處理。

      一、ajax語法

      復制代碼 代碼如下:

      jQuery.ajax([settings])

      參數說明

      settings:用于配置 Ajax 請求的鍵值對集合?梢酝ㄟ^ $.ajaxSetup() 設置任何選項的默認值。

      二、ajax的datatype選項的值

      1、"xml":返回 XML 文檔,可用 jQuery 處理。

      2、"html"::返回純文本 HTML 信息;包含的 script 標簽會在插入 dom 時執行。

      3、"script"::返回純文本JavaScript 代碼。不會自動緩存結果,除非設置了 "cache" 參數。注意:在遠程請求時(不在同一個域下),所有 POST 請求都將轉為 GET 請求。(因為將使用 DOM 的 script標簽來加載)

      4、"json": 返回 JSON 數據 。

      5、"jsonp": JSONP 格式。使用JSONP 形式調用函數時,如 "myurl" jQuery 將自動替換 ? 為正確的函數名,以執行回調函數,經常被用來同主域名下不同二級域名下的跨域請求。

      6、"text": 返回純文本字符串。

      下面是關于jquery ajax中的datatype相關問題

      datatype設置為html的時候返回的只是純文本,沒有什么好說的,設置成xml的時候返回的是一個xml document對象,

      比如返回下面這么一個xml

      < xml version="1.0" encoding="utf-8" >

    110000北京市120000天津市

      這就需要用XMLDocument之類來操作,還要考慮瀏覽器

      其實jquery本身也可以解析xml,舉個簡單的例子

      $.ajax({type: "Get",dataType: "xml",url: "test.xml",success: function(datas){$("province",datas).each(function(i){ alert($($("provinceID",datas)[i]).text() + "_" + $(this).text());});}});

      test.xml里面的內容就是上面的xml,這樣datas就是返回的xml文檔對象,lz可以自己試一試

      其實相對來說我更喜歡使用datatype:"json",使用json數據對于javascript來說解析起來就更方便了

    【怎樣理解jquery中ajax的dataType屬性選項值】相關文章:

    如何理解jquery事件冒泡09-15

    jQuery中prev()方法用法07-16

    jQuery中replaceAll()方法用法10-15

    jQuery中parent()和siblings()的問題10-16

    怎樣做好英語閱讀理解09-17

    怎樣理解中外合作辦學項目01-15

    jQuery程序設計08-05

    jquery提交按鈕的代碼07-28

    AJAX的工作原理及優缺點08-16

    企法顧問清算中公司的法律屬性問題01-22

    主站蜘蛛池模板: 日韩精品无码久久一区二区三| 午夜欧美精品久久久久久久| 香蕉国产精品麻豆亚洲欧美日韩精品自拍欧美v国 | 亚洲av无码成人精品区在线播放| 亚洲国产成人精品不卡青青草原| 久久精品一本到99热免费| 久久精品国产亚洲Aⅴ香蕉| 亚洲成人精品久久| 国产福利在线观看精品| 久久久国产乱子伦精品作者 | 精品久久久久久国产三级| 久久久久国产精品| 国产精品高清一区二区三区| 亚洲国产精品无码久久久蜜芽| 久久精品亚洲乱码伦伦中文 | 91久久精品国产成人久久| 国产成人精品天堂| 99在线精品视频在线观看| 久久精品人人做人人爽电影蜜月| 亚洲国产精品成人| 欧洲精品码一区二区三区免费看| 精品熟女少妇aⅴ免费久久| 91精品国产综合久久四虎久久无码一级 | 国产精品国产AV片国产| 国产精品视频免费| aaa级精品久久久国产片| 2020国产精品永久在线| 久久精品国产亚洲AV电影| 亚洲国产成人一区二区精品区| 亚洲国产精品丝袜在线观看| 国产在AJ精品| 精品欧美一区二区在线观看| 国产线视频精品免费观看视频| 99久久er这里只有精品18| 精品国产一区二区三区免费| 久久精品无码一区二区无码| 久久久久99精品成人片试看| 精品熟女少妇av免费久久| 色偷偷88888欧美精品久久久| 日产精品一线二线三线芒果| 久久久久99精品成人片试看|